This International Standard establishes the principles
and specifies the procedures for developing Type III
environmental declaration programmes and Type III
environmental declarations. It specifically establishes
the use of the ISO 14040 series of standards in the
development of Type III environmental declaration
programmes and Type III environmental declarations.
This International Standard establishes principles for
the use of environmental information, in addition to
those given in ISO 14020.
Type III environmental declarations as described in this
International Standard are primarily intended for use in
business-to-business communication, but their use in
business-to-consumer communication under certain
conditions is not precluded.
This International Standard does not override, or in any
way change, legally required environmental information,
claims or labelling, or any other applicable legal requirements.
This International Standard does not include sectorspecific
provisions, which may be dealt with in other
ISO documents. It is intended that sector-specific provisions
in other ISO documents related to Type III environmental
declarations be based on and use the principles
and procedures of this International Standard.
